Al Ain airport information

Al Ain International Airport (AAN): Al Ain International Airport, just 18 km/11 miles from the city center, offers a smooth travel experience with a single terminal, modern check-in facilities, and quick access to the city’s cultural and natural attractions. Serving over 100,000 passengers a year, it’s also expanding through the Nibras Al Ain Aerospace Park1 to support the region’s growing aviation future.

Documents required for Kuwait to Al_ Ain flights

Passport and visa requirements

Be sure to have a valid passport and visa before you fly with us. You can find more information on Al Ain's visa requirements here.

Flight tickets

Before you fly with us, ensure that your onward and return tickets are booked in advance.

Travel insurance

Ensure that you have valid travel insurance to access necessary assistance and coverage in case of emergencies.

Forex and debit/credit cards

To ensure smooth transactions, please carry internationally recognized Forex, credit and debit cards.

Customs and immigration forms

For goods that require declaration, ensure you have the customs and immigration forms filled in advance.

International driving permit

If you want to rent a vehicle, ensure you have an international driving permit and a valid domestic driver’s license.

FAQs

Can I find halal and modest dining options in Al Ain? +
Yes, and they’re delicious. From traditional Emirati dishes to international flavors, Al Ain’s food scene respects every palate and preference.
What’s the best time to book your flights to Al Ain? +
Between November and March when the desert cools, the gardens bloom, and every sunset feels like a postcard.
Do I need a visa to visit Al Ain?+
Depends on your passport. Some travelers get visa-free entry, others need to apply in advance. Check the UAE Government Visa Portal before you pack.
How do I get around Al Ain once I land?+
Taxis, rental cars, and local buses make it easy. Whether you're chasing mountain views or mall deals, Al Ain moves at your pace.
Is Al Ain family-friendly?+
Absolutely. From camel markets to zoos, hot springs to theme parks, Al Ain is built for memory-making across generations.
What are the Passport and visa requirements?+
Before you fly, make sure your passport has at least 6 months of validity and a blank page for stamping. Depending on where you're from, you might need a visa to enter Al Ain, or you might get one on arrival. It’s always a good idea to check the latest entry rules before you fly.
